Kyle Schwarber of the Chicago Cubs blasted a sixth inning grand slam home run to spur a five run inning and lead them to a 10-5 win over the Milwaukee Brewers Thursday night in game one of their NL Central series at Miller Park. The loss drops the Brewers 7 1/2 games behind St Louis in the divisional race and five back of Chicago for the second NL wild card. The two teams meet in game two Friday night with Cole Hamels (7-5) going against Zack Davies (8-7).
